Reach target volumes faster and with fewer surprises. We stabilise new or scaled production by aligning capacity, materials, processes and systems into a single plan.
Data-driven planning, dynamic simulation and supplier-agnostic automation expertise turn a risky ramp into a predictable one, with clear accountability and measurable outcomes.
A phased roadmap with gates, named owners and risks that are actively controlled.
Line design and buffers verified through dynamic simulation before commissioning.
Human and machine capacity balanced against realistic demand scenarios.
Inbound, WIP and finished-goods policies aligned to takt and changeover reality.
Feasibility, business case, vendor selection and supervised commissioning.
Live KPIs and reporting that let management actually steer the ramp.
